MFV Louisa Fisherman Lachlann Armstrong’s battle for survival: “I didn’t know if I’d make it”

Lachlann Armstrong with sister Dana Afrin and mother, Amanda DarlingA fisherman who swam through icy waters and clung onto rocks after his boat sank off the Outer Hebrides has spoken of his dramatic battle for survival and the “heartbreaking” moment he realised his friends were lost. Lachlann Armstrong admitted last night he did not know if he would make it to shore after he abandoned the MFV Louisa’s life raft when it failed to inflate. The 27-year-old father said he decided to try to reach the shore to free up space on the semi-submerged raft and help save his colleagues.
